Children Of The Dawn

Rating: 5.0


Children of the dawn,
Go play in the corn!
Burn the house down,
And wear the sky as your crown!

You came from the stars,
With hair as red as Mars,
Down to Earth in a lightning bolt,
To break the rules and revolt!
